Semantic Annotation Automatic of Curriculum Lattes Using Linked Open Data

Abstract

The Semantic Web has the purpose of optimizing document recovery, where these documents received synonyms, allowing people and machines to understand the meaning of one information. The semantic annotation entity is the path to promote the semantic in documents. This paper has an objective to build an outline with the Semantic Web concepts that allow to automatically annotate entities in the Lattes Curriculum based on Linked Open Data (LOD), which store terms and expressions’ meaning. The problem addressed in this research is based on what of the Semantic Web concepts can contribute to the Automatic Semantic Annotation Entities of the Lattes Curriculum using Linked Open Data. During the literature review the concepts, tools and technologies related to the theme were presented. The application of these concepts allowed the creation of the Semantic Web Lattes System. An empirical study was conducted with the objective of identifying an Extraction Tool Entity further Effective. The system allows importing the XML curricula in the Lattes Platform, annotates automatically the available data using the open databases and allows to run semantic queries.
